Phosphorus has 5 electrons in the outermost shell. By octet rule atom tends to combine in such a way that they’ll have 8 electrons in the valence shell. So phosphorous either gain 3 electrons or lose 5 electrons (phosphorous has 8 electrons in the second shell) while combining.

So I understand that an atom can gain or lose electrons and still retain it's identity - for example a Carbon atom is still carbon even if it loses 5 of it's 6 electrons because it is the number of protons that make it what it is. But it is also still Carbon if it gains electrons (becoming an ion).
